The biological function of the male hormones (androgens) is orchestrated through the activation of the androgen receptor-mediated signaling events that are central to the development and maintenance of primary male sexual and secondary male characteristics. The androgen receptor belongs to the superfamily of nuclear receptors and functions as a transcription factor. The role of androgen signaling is well established in normal growth and development of the prostate gland. The androgen signaling dysfunctions due to alterations of androgen receptor and signaling molecules both upstream and downstream of androgen receptor are critical to prostate cancer progression after androgen deprivation therapy (ADT). Therapeutic targeting of various components of this biochemical pathway has remained the mainstay in the management of the advanced disease. Unfortunately, resistance to androgen signaling targeted drugs is inevitable. To overcome these challenges, new therapeutic strategies have continued to evolve including next generation of androgen receptor and androgen biosynthesis inhibitors, as well as chemotherapy agents and cancer driver mutation-targeted therapies. This review focuses on alterations of the key components of androgen signaling, especially the androgen receptor and the current state-of-the-art therapeutic strategies targeting this pathway in the management of advanced prostate cancer.
